Excede®, which contains the active ingredient ceftiofur crystalline free acid, is a broad-spectrum antibiotic specifically designed for the treatment of bacterial respiratory disease in cattle. It is particularly effective against common pathogens such as Mannheimia haemolytica, Pasteurella multocida, and Histophilus somni, which are often implicated in shipping fever and other respiratory infections that can plague cattle, especially during times of stress, such as transport or weaning.

One of the most critical aspects of dog internal medicine is the diagnostic process. Veterinarians employ various diagnostic tools and procedures to evaluate a dog's health. These methods may include blood tests, urine analysis, imaging techniques like X-rays and ultrasounds, and sometimes, advanced diagnostics like endoscopy or biopsies. Each of these tools provides crucial insights into a pet's health, enabling vets to differentiate between various conditions and tailor treatment approaches accordingly.

Joint problems in horses can arise from various sources, such as aging, high-impact activities, and injuries. Common conditions that affect horses include arthritis, tendonitis, and synovitis. These issues can lead to pain, reduced mobility, and ultimately, a decrease in performance. Joint supplements can play a vital role in preventing and managing these conditions by improving joint function and reducing inflammation.
In addition to pharmacological treatments, supportive care is vital to improve recovery rates in coughing poultry. Ensuring proper ventilation in housing, maintaining hygiene, and providing a stress-free environment can reduce the incidence and severity of respiratory illnesses. Supplementing the diet with vitamins, particularly A, C, and E, can bolster the immune response and accelerate recovery.

Goats suffering from diarrhea may exhibit several symptoms, including watery stools, lethargy, loss of appetite, dehydration, and, in severe cases, weight loss. Quick identification of these signs is crucial, as failure to treat can lead to dehydration and electrolyte imbalances, particularly in young kids.

Like any medication, albendazole plus tablets can have side effects. Common adverse effects include gastrointestinal symptoms such as nausea, vomiting, and abdominal pain. However, these are usually mild and resolve quickly. Serious side effects are rare but can occur, particularly in cases of prolonged use or in patients with underlying health conditions. Therefore, it is crucial for healthcare providers to assess the patient's history and monitor for any potential adverse reactions.

Preventing loose motion in cattle begins with good management practices. Maintaining a consistent diet, observing cattle for any signs of distress, and ensuring proper sanitation in living quarters can greatly reduce the incidence of diarrhea. Vaccination against specific viruses, such as BVDV, can also offer significant protection.

Poly V belts, also known as serpentine belts or multi-V belts, are essential components in various machinery, ranging from automotive engines to industrial equipment. These belts are known for their high flexibility and numerous small grooves, allowing them to grip more surfaces than standard belts. As a result, they offer improved performance, efficiency, and longer life spans. Moreover, the fan belt impacts the vehicle's electrical systems by driving the alternator. The alternator is responsible for charging the vehicle's battery and powering electrical components, such as headlights, infotainment systems, and navigation tools. If the fan belt fails, the alternator will not function properly, leading to dimming lights and, eventually, a dead battery.
